Attach the trolley’s release lever to the red release
handle with the cord supplied so the handle is 6 feet
from the oor. Cut off any excess cord.
6 FEET FROM
THE FLOOR
Close the door. Align the top edge of the door
bracket 2” to 4” below the top edge of the door.
Align the vertical centerline drawn on the door with
the center of the bracket and mark holes.
If required, drill 3/16” pilot holes for mounting
bracket. Do not drill completely through the door.
Secure door bracket with two 1/4”x3/4” self-tapping
bolts (supplied). The self-tapping bolts are NOT
FOR USE ON WOOD DOORS!

Fiberglass, aluminum or lightweight steel
doors WILL REQUIRE reinforcement
before installation of door bracket. If your
door doesn’t have a reinforced mounting
support built in, contact door manufacturer
or garage door professional for instructions
on reinforcement or reinforcement kits for
using automatic door openers.
